This is a description of a homeopathic medicine called Calcarea Fluorica. It contains approximately 80 pellets and is made in France. The medicine is meant to be used for repeated sprains. The active ingredient is not specifically mentioned in the text. It is advised to consult a health professional before use, especially during pregnancy or breastfeeding. The pellets should be dissolved under the tongue three times a day or as directed by a doctor. The inactive ingredients include lactose and sucrose. The medicine is distributed by Boiron Inc. located in Newtown Square, PA. Instructions for dispensing the pellets are also provided.*
